Since the daylight saving time change. We are having
trouble with users calender appointments being 1 hour off.
We are using Exchange 5.5/Outlook 2000. In Outlook we had
them check the box indicating adjustment for daylight
saving time. After 2 days the time changed back an hour
again. This seems to be only happening with our XP users
only. Any ideas what is causing this.

Check the Time Zone settings in Outlook.

Select the TOOLS menu
Select OPTIONS...
Click the CALENDAR OPTIONS... button
Click the TIME ZONE... button

There is also a little check mark in the time zone area
for DST (Daylight Savings Time). Check to see if that
should be on or off.

Also check their CONTROL PANEL | DATE/TIME
in Windows.

The following article can help in some cases:

OL2000: Changing the Time Zone Without Changing Appointment Times:
http://support.microsoft.com/?kbid=197480
